Sri Lanka to re-open A/L and O/L Classes of government schools from November month. Director General of Health Services says health guideless issued to resume A/L and O/L classes in government schools. Reopening dates to be decided by Education Ministry.

The schools were shut April 27 when Sri Lanka found that 3rd COVID cluster has emerged.

Sri Lanka re-opened primary schools from October 25 after keeping them closed for 175 days due to the lockdown and travel restrictions imposed to contain the spread of the coronavirus.
